About the Book

The Westland Wyvern was a troubled British strike fighter aircraft that has been largely forgotten…at least in our world. At the far corners of the cosmos, in a world of light and beauty hitherto unknown to humans, it is a legend!

​It’s 1956, in the heat of the Suez Canal Crisis, and a flight of Royal Navy aviators, among them Canadian exchange officer Sidney Daventry, has just survived a harrowing encounter with the enemy, but something even more terrifying awaits: a swirling vortex, a wormhole into an alien world. When they arrive, they find they’re not the only Earthlings marooned there, for two American scientists from 2026, Lucretia Tang and her brother Jeremiah, have also gotten caught up in the storm.

​Though desperate to get back to the world they know, Lucretia and Sidney learn of a grave threat to the Racosku, the alien planet’s native species. Desperate to help the brilliant and friendly creatures, they must convince the others to risk the very machines they need to get home.

Why the Wyvern?

An author’s inspiration often comes from the most unexpected places. This one came from a meme among aviation enthusiasts.

Back when I was still active on social media, I encountered a number of fellow #avgeeks harboring a particular fascination with the Westland Wyvern, a troubled, short-lived, strange-looking British strike fighter of the 1950s. It was a devoted following, to be sure—an almost cultlike one!

But why an aircraft whose service life lasted less than five years? Why not some sleek, sexy fast jet or a legendary veteran of the Second World War? I set upon a challenge to discover the origins of this Cult of the Wyvern, determining that no explanation was too outrageous. And so the answer quickly became obvious:

Just add aliens.
